Dependable and High-Performing Drive Technology
In the sector of modern machinery, stable and efficient drive technology is mandatory. Drive systems communicate motion, maintaining smooth operation and optimal effectiveness. A quality drive system can raise the lifespan of a device, reduce maintenance costs, and improve overall productivity.
Evaluating the right drive technology depends on the specific requirements of an application. Factors to review include payload capacity, motion rate, torque power, and situational factors. Innovative drive technologies often utilize detectors, controllers, and monitoring systems to achieve exact control and boost energy efficiency.

Capitalizing on PLC Data for Predictive Maintenance
Forecast-based maintenance has reshaped industries by detecting potential equipment failures before they occur. By reviewing the vast amount of data generated by Programmable Logic Controllers (PLCs), we can gain valuable insights into machine performance and identify initial warning signs. This analytics-supported approach allows for advance maintenance procedures, minimizing downtime, extending equipment life, and reducing overall operational costs.
Making use of advanced analytics techniques, such as machine learning, enables the identification of complex patterns and correlations within PLC data. These findings can be used to anticipate potential failures with excellent dependability. By employing predictive maintenance practices based on PLC data analysis, industries can achieve a precautionary approach to equipment management, ultimately leading to increased efficiency, reliability, and profitability.
